Output 1ec9cfa4e4d207d00a82db85bead53d559dd4dc544d65c50cab256d5e2b0d019:2

value
24610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64b89bb7f379c4c7f62f23478e6cfb8545fb7e1 OP_EQUAL
address
3KmWCzvzdLL8VE2df5sXVqyEXQ9nCR4Prt
transaction
1ec9cfa4e4d207d00a82db85bead53d559dd4dc544d65c50cab256d5e2b0d019
confirmations
458763
spent
true